3Public HearingPublic Hearing – Recommendation to the City of Petaluma Historic and Cultural Preservation Committee to Conduct a Public Hearing and Consider a Resolution Approving Historic Site Plan and Architectural Review, Subject to Conditions of Approval, for Proposed Modifications to an Existing ca. 1955 Single Family Residence, Including Construction of an Approximately ±851­square­foot Half­story Addition, the Dwelling Would Be Expanded From a One­story Structure to a 1½­story Configuration By Constructing a New Half­story Above the Existing Ground Floor Within the Existing Building Footprint, Installation of New Dormer Elements on the Front Elevation, Relocation of the Primary Entrance to Face Kent Street, Construction of an Approximately 16­foot by 5­foot Front Porch, Installation of New Windows on All Elevations, and Replacement of Roof Materials with Composition Shingles, Located in the Oakhill­Brewster Historic District at 307 Kent St., APN 006­156­013, City Record No. PLSR­2025­0006. THIS MEETING ITEM WAS PUBLISHED ON WEDNESDAY, DECEMBER 31, 2025.
The Historic and Cultural Preservation Committee will hold a public hearing to review and decide whether to approve renovations to a 1955 house at 307 Kent Street in the Oakhill-Brewster Historic District, including adding a half-story to make it 1.5 stories tall, adding dormers, moving the front entrance, building a front porch, replacing windows, and putting on a new roof.
4Public HearingPublic Hearing – Recommendation to the City of Petaluma Historic and Cultural Preservation Committee to Conduct a Public Hearing and Consider a Resolution Approving Historic Site Plan and Architectural Review Approving Historic Site Plan and Architectural Review, Subject to Conditions of Approval, for Proposed Modifications to an Existing ca. 1908 Single­Family Residence, Including a 450­Square­Foot Addition to the Rear of the Structure, Construction of a Rear Raised Deck and Pergola, and Like­For­ Like Replacement of Exterior Windows and Finishes, Located in the Oakhill­Brewster Historic District at 528 Oak St., APN 006­202­011, City Record No: PLSR­2025­
The Historic and Cultural Preservation Committee will hold a public hearing to review and decide whether to approve modifications to a 1908 house at 528 Oak Street in the Oakhill-Brewster Historic District, including a 450-square-foot rear addition, a raised deck with pergola, and replacement of exterior windows and finishes.
